Loma Del Sol, Davenport, FL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Loma Del Sol?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Loma Del Sol Studio Apartments | $1,485 | $1,235 | $3,537 |
| Loma Del Sol 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,630 | $1,345 | $2,752 |
| Loma Del Sol 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,973 | $1,488 | $3,182 |
Loma Del Sol 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,302 | $1,748 | $3,218 |
| Loma Del Sol 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,594 | $1,973 | $7,605 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Loma Del Sol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Loma Del Sol with 3 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Loma Del Sol is at The Legends at ChampionsGate listed at $1,748.
How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Loma Del Sol Apartment?
The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Loma Del Sol is $2,302.
What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Loma Del Sol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Loma Del Sol is a 1,758 square feet unit starting from $2,687 at Reunion Crossing Townhomes.
What is the average size for Loma Del Sol 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Loma Del Sol is currently 1,686 sq ft.
